The Grandstander Bully

Definitinon

The Grandstander Bully

The grandstander bully is a shadow of the boy-hero archetype. The grandstander bully feels that he is superior to others and that he should mask his insecurities by exploiting those of others through phyisical or verbal abuse.

Examples

In the Nickelodeon series The Fairly Odd Parents from the 2000s, Francis, the bully of the protagonist's school, is the spitting image of the grandstander bully; he bullys the protagonist constantly to make himself forget about his insecuritiea and assert his perceived superiority.
